Talbetalia or New Life Colony is a place full of life, in which there live twisted, broken figures, whose heads, however, are erect and steady.The protagonist of this story comes to settle in the colony after recovering from a terrible disease…. for which there is no graver outcome than recovery. All the deformed figures in New Life Colony are isolated from the outer world. A barrier of hatred stands between those fragmented human beings and complete men.Subhas Mukopadhyay’s narration of the story of those outcasts is marked by great sensitivity and subtlety…. its humaneness deepened, perhaps, by the poet in him.
